Capron is located in Illinois. Capron, Illinois has a population of 1,749. Capron is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 34.47%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 35.46%.
The median household income in Capron, Illinois is $54,286. The median household income for the surrounding county is $62,701 compared to the national median of $57,652. The median age of people living in Capron is 31.9 years.
The average high temperature in July is 82.9 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 11.2 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 36.6 inches per year, with 33.5 inches of snow per year.
